What does Error Code 2000 mean?

To put it simply, this error means that the ePSA could not successfully read information from the hard drive. Faulty or misaligned cabling in your computer’s case, connecting your hard drive to the motherboard. Corrupted data or MBR (Master Boot Record) on the hard disk, causing the device to crash.

How do I troubleshoot my Dell laptop battery?

  1. Verify AC adapter functionality.
  2. Charge the battery in BIOS mode or with the laptop turned off.
  3. Run the Dell hardware diagnostic test.
  4. Check the battery health status.
  5. Update the BIOS and Dell Quickset.
  6. Run Windows Troubleshooter for battery issues.
  7. Uninstall and reinstall Microsoft ACPI Battery driver.

How do I check my RAM on Windows?

How to Test RAM With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ool

  1. Search for “Windows Memory Diagnostic” in your start menu, and run the application.
  2. Select “Restart now and check for problems.” Windows will automatically restart, run the test and reboot back into Windows.
  3. Once restarted, wait for the result message.

How do I exit Dell ePSA pre boot system assessment?

Press Esc key to stop ePSA and click Exit to safely exit ePSA diagnostics and reboot the PC.

How do you hard reset a Dell computer?

Restore your Dell computer using Windows Push-Button Reset

  1. Click Start.
  2. Select Reset this PC (System Setting).
  3. Under Reset this PC, select Get Started.
  4. Select the option to Remove everything.
  5. If you are keeping this computer, select Just remove my files.
  6.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the reset process.

What does error code 2000-0146 mean on Dell laptop?

Error code 0146 indicates the test has detected logs of previous errors on hard drive and this might be a possible hard drive failure. For more decisive results, I recommend you to run a ‘Custom Test’ on the laptop’s ‘Hard Drive’.

What is the DST log error code 2000-0146?

Hi, Error code: 2000-0146 (DST Log contains previous errors) refers to previous errors in the hard drive which might not really be a hardware failure. Once the Pre-boot System Assessment is completed, the computer will give you an option to “Run the remaining memory test”, please select “No”.
